Terrina Chrishell

 Terrina Christopherhell Stause was born on July 21, 1982. She is most famous for her character Amanda Dillon in All My Children as well as Jordan Ridgeway on Days of Our Lives. Stause was born in Draffenville in Kentucky. She studied at Murray State University and received her B.A. In 2003, she was an actress in the theater. The name she uses for her middle name "Chrishell" is an evocative word that was created based on the unusual circumstances surrounding her birth when her mother went into labor at the Shell station with an attendant named Chris assisted in the delivery of the baby.
